Japan Proposes Two-Tier Crypto Regulation Framework

Japan released a two-tiered crypto regulation framework on October 25, 2023, focusing on balancing innovation and investor protection nationwide.

The initiative is significant because it aims to strike a balance between fostering blockchain innovation and safeguarding investors against market risks.

Japan Introduces Layered Approach to Crypto Regulation

The Japanese government has proposed a two-tiered framework for cryptocurrency regulation aimed at ensuring broader investor protection. The framework aligns with global trends to regulate the fast-evolving digital market.

Cryptocurrency stakeholders and policymakers are involved in shaping this regulation. The outlined actions demonstrate Japan’s commitment to integrating blockchain technology while establishing investor safeguards.
